当前位置:首页 > 技术文章 > web前端

  • JavaScript Promise 返回数组却显示 undefined 如何解决?
    JavaScript Promise 返回数组却显示 undefined 如何解决?
    JavaScriptPromise返回数组却显示undefined的问题在使用Promise...
    web前端 . promise 1063 2024-10-25 13:49:15
  • 教程:在 JavaScript 中从头开始实现 Polyfills PromiseallSettled
    教程:在 JavaScript 中从头开始实现 Polyfills PromiseallSettled
    javascript在es2020中引入了promise.allsettled,以便更轻松地处理多个异步操作。与promise.all不同,promise.allsettled在promise被拒绝时会短路,promise.allsettled可确保您从所有promise中获得结果,无论它们成功还是失败。在本教程中,我将引导您创建自己的promise.allsettled实现,重点是从头开始构建它。我们还将探索promise在幕后如何工作,帮助您了解使javascript如此强大的异步行为。什么
    web前端 . promise 358 2024-10-25 10:45:01
  • React 自动批处理:如何最小化重新渲染并提高性能
    React 自动批处理:如何最小化重新渲染并提高性能
    在大型react应用程序中,浪费的重新渲染可能是一个严重的问题,它会降低性能并使您的应用程序感觉缓慢。在react18中,自动批处理通过减少不必要的重新渲染来帮助优化性能,为开发人员提供更有效的方式来管理状态更新。本指南将引导您了解react18中自动批处理的概念、为什么它对性能如此重要,以及如何在您的应用程序中充分利用它。简介:大型react应用程序中浪费渲染的问题假设您正在做饭,而不是一次制作所有菜肴,而是不断来回单独制作每道菜-显然效率不高,对吧?当状态更新被一一处理时,react中也会发
    web前端 . promise 793 2024-10-24 18:15:21
  • JavaScript 主题
    JavaScript 主题
    以下是每个JavaScript主题的简要说明:变量和数据类型:变量存储数据值,JavaScript支持多种数据类型,如字符串、数字、布尔值、数组和对象。var、let和const用于声明变量。函数(箭头函数、函数表达式):函数是设计用于执行特定任务的代码块。箭头函数(=>)是一种用于编写函数的较短语法。函数表达式允许将函数定义为表达式的一部分。作用域(全局、局部、块):作用域决定变量的可访问性。全局作用域使变量可以在整个程序中访问,可以在函数内访问局部作用域,也可以在块内访问块作用域(例如,在{
    web前端 . promise 558 2024-10-23 18:41:44
  • js如何抓取网页
    js如何抓取网页
    JavaScript提供多种方法抓取网页数据,包括:DOM解析(Document Object Model):使用DOM接口提取元素和内容。正则表达式:使用模式匹配从文本中提取数据。AJAX(XMLHttpRequest):与服务器通信,在不刷新网页的情况下获取数据。第三方库:例如Cheerio、Jsoup、Axios,简化抓取过程。
    web前端 . promise 386 2024-10-23 13:04:00
  • js如何实现并发请求
    js如何实现并发请求
    JavaScript 实现并发请求可以通过:Fetch API:使用 Fetch API 创建请求数组,并用 Promise.all() 处理响应。XMLHttpRequest (XHR):创建并监听多个 XHR 请求,当 readyState 为 4 时处理响应。Promise:使用 Promise.all() 封装请求并处理响应。async/await:使用 async/await 编写异步函数,逐个等待请求完成。
    web前端 . promise 380 2024-10-23 08:18:29
  • 如何提高js编程能力
    如何提高js编程能力
    要提升 JavaScript 编程能力,应采取以下步骤:1. 掌握基础知识:包括语法、数据类型和核心概念。2. 实践:编写小程序和脚本,练习语法和理解概念。3. 寻求指导:参加在线课程或加入编码社区,获得指导和反馈。4. 进阶篇:理解面向对象编程、 maîtriser 异步编程并学习框架和库。5. 提高篇:编写测试用例、重构代码并学习新技术。此外,建议参与开源项目、构建个人项目并寻求导师的指导。
    web前端 . promise 684 2024-10-23 06:21:17
  • js如何阻塞
    js如何阻塞
    JavaScript 单线程特性会导致它通过事件循环阻塞浏览器执行其他任务,从而影响页面性能。为了避免阻塞,可以使用 Web Workers、异步编程和流式处理等非阻塞技术。
    web前端 . promise 512 2024-10-23 04:06:40
  • js如何获取图片
    js如何获取图片
    要使用 JavaScript 获取图片,可以使用 document.querySelector()、document.createElement('img') 或 new Image()。获取图片后,可以使用 src、alt、width、height 和事件监听器等属性和方法对其进行操作。例如,img.width 获取图片的宽度,img.addEventListener('load', () => {}) 在图片加载后添加事件监听器。
    web前端 . promise 382 2024-10-23 02:57:19
  • 如何学好js
    如何学好js
    掌握 JavaScript 的方法包括:理解基本语法,包括变量、数据类型、运算符和控制流。熟悉 HTML 和 CSS,并练习编写简单脚本。掌握核心概念,如函数、对象、数组和事件处理。通过编写交互式 web 界面来实践和应用 JavaScript 代码。使用 JavaScript 库和框架来简化任务。学习异步编程、ES6 和最新 JavaScript 版本。了解设计模式和最佳实践,并持续学习。
    web前端 . promise 568 2024-10-23 00:51:19
  • Promiseall() 的 Polyfill
    Promiseall() 的 Polyfill
    promise.all()函数输入:需要promise数组(不是必需的)输出:它返回promise,其中包含所有成功promise的结果数组。注意:如果任何承诺失败,则立即拒绝。promise.myall()的代码`promise.myall=函数(承诺){返回新的promise(函数(解决,拒绝){//检查输入是否是数组if(!array.isarray(promises)){returnreject(newtypeerror("参数必须是数组"));}letresults=[];letcom
    web前端 . promise 368 2024-10-22 18:32:35
  • typescript哪些好用的技巧
    typescript哪些好用的技巧
    TypeScript 提供了许多实用技巧,如:类型推断:自动推断变量类型,简化代码。类型别名:创建复杂或可重复类型别名。联合类型:允许变量存储多个类型。类型保护和断言:检查和缩小变量类型。异步编程:提供对 Promise 和 async/await 的一流支持。错误处理:包含健壮的错误处理功能,如 try...catch 和 throw。
    web前端 . promise 626 2024-10-22 14:06:29
  • typescript做什么呢
    typescript做什么呢
    TypeScript 是一种强类型语言,用于构建现代 Web 和 Node.js 应用程序。其主要用途包括:强类型检查,防止类型错误。代码重构,简化维护。面向对象编程,创建可重用代码。泛型,创建可用于不同数据类型的组件。与 JavaScript 互操作,兼容现有代码库。异步编程支持,管理异步操作。模块化开发,提升代码可管理性。单元测试支持,确保代码可靠性。
    web前端 . promise 1140 2024-10-22 11:40:02
  • typescript能做什么
    typescript能做什么
    TypeScript 是一种 JavaScript 扩展,提供静态类型检查、面向对象编程、模块化、泛型和异步编程功能,从而构建可维护、复杂的 JavaScript 应用程序。
    web前端 . promise 388 2024-10-22 11:31:36
  • 使用 React 构建时您应该了解的库
    使用 React 构建时您应该了解的库
    在本文中,我将讨论您可以在React项目中使用的库。如果你喜欢我的文章,可以请我一杯咖啡:)给我买咖啡1.样式组件它是一个使CSS在React应用程序中基于组件编写的库。由于它具有基于组件的结构,因此它允许您以模块化方式单独设置每个组件的样式。它还提供动态样式和主题之间的切换等功能。安装npm我的样式组件纱线添加样式组件2.福米克——是的Formik在表单验证、表单提交操作和formik状态管理等方面提供了极大的便利。它简化了错误管理和验证过程,特别是在处理大型且复杂的表单时。安装npmifor
    web前端 . promise 843 2024-10-21 08:09:01

PHP讨论组

组员:3305人话题:1500

PHP一种被广泛应用的开放源代码的多用途脚本语言,和其他技术相比,php本身开源免费; 可以将程序嵌入于HTML中去执行, 执行效率比完全生成htmL标记的CGI要高许多,它运行在服务器端,消耗的系统资源相当少,具有跨平台强、效率高的特性,而且php支持几乎所有流行的数据库以及操作系统,最重要的是

学习途径

工具推荐

jQuery企业留言表单联系代码

jQuery企业留言表单联系代码是一款简洁实用的企业留言表单和联系我们介绍页面代码。
表单按钮
2024-02-29

HTML5 MP3音乐盒播放特效

HTML5 MP3音乐盒播放特效是一款基于html5+css3制作可爱的音乐盒表情,点击开关按钮mp3音乐播放器。
播放器特效
2024-02-29

HTML5炫酷粒子动画导航菜单特效

HTML5炫酷粒子动画导航菜单特效是一款导航菜单采用鼠标悬停变色的特效。
菜单导航
2024-02-29

jQuery可视化表单拖拽编辑代码

jQuery可视化表单拖拽编辑代码是一款基于jQuery和bootstrap框架制作可视化表单。
表单按钮
2024-02-29

wechat-miniprogram-plugin

wechat-miniprogram-plugin是基于JetBrains平台的微信小程序插件。主要功能wxml/wxss/wxs文件支持语法解析代码完成代码高亮wxml嵌入表达式支持wxml 标签支持wxml提取自定义组件创建微信小程序组件以及页面相关文件导航微信小程序自定义组件支持自动注册自定义组件组件配置解析重命名小程序自定义组件或页面同时移动自定义组件或页面的所有文件微信小程序配置文件支持代码检查以及自动修复支持QQ小程序支持NPM中的组件安装可通过以下两种方式安装,在这之前请确保安装并启用了J
微信源码
2025-06-12

WeUI微信UI库

WeUI是由微信官方设计团队专为微信移动Web应用设计的UI库。
微信源码
2025-06-12

PHP轻论坛

简介PHP轻论坛是一个简单易用的PHP论坛程序,适合小型社区和个人网站使用。v3.0版本是完全重构的版本,解决了之前版本中的所有已知问题,特别是MySQL保留字冲突问题。主要特点• 简单易用:简洁的界面,易于安装和使用• 响应式设计:适配各种设备,包括手机和平板• 安全可靠:避免使用MySQL保留字,防止SQL注入• 功能完善:支持分类、主题、回复、用户管理等基本功能• 易于扩展:模块化设计,便于添加新功能系统要求• PHP 7.4 或更高版本• MySQL 5.6 或更高版本 / MariaDB 10
微信源码
2025-06-11

HDHCMS (集网站建站与客户管理于一体的系统)

HDHCMS自2025年3月13日起取消授权功能,前台展示完全不受授权限制。 下载系统上线后要先运行后台URL才可正常运行。 URL首先要运行:http://主域名/admin/ HDHCMS是一款轻量级的专注于企业网站建设、企业办公管理与企业客户管理的内容管理系统,同步支持PC与手机网站的建设,后台支持微信公众号的接入。 开发脚本为ASP.Net(C#),数据库支持MSSQL。 网站建设方面可实现网站
微信源码
2025-06-11

蓝色极简风格夏日主题竖版banner下载

蓝色极简风格夏日主题竖版banner适用于夏日主题banner设计 本作品提供蓝色极简风格夏日主题竖版banner的图片会员免费下载,格式为PSD,文件大小为215KB; 请使用软件Photoshop进行编辑,作品中文字及图均可以通过软件修改和编辑;
psd素材
2025-06-11

可爱的夏天元素矢量素材(EPS+PNG)

这是一款可爱的夏天元素矢量素材,包含了太阳、遮阳帽、椰子树、比基尼、飞机、西瓜、冰淇淋、雪糕、冷饮、游泳圈、人字拖、菠萝、海螺、贝壳、海星、螃蟹、柠檬、防晒霜、太阳镜等等,素材提供了 EPS 和免扣 PNG 两种格式,含 JPG 预览图。
PNG素材
2024-02-29

四个红的的 2023 毕业徽章矢量素材(AI+EPS+PNG)

这是一款红的的 2023 毕业徽章矢量素材,共四个,提供了 AI 和 EPS 和免扣 PNG 等格式,含 JPG 预览图。
PNG素材
2024-02-29

唱歌的小鸟和装满花朵的推车设计春天banner矢量素材(AI+EPS)

这是一款由唱歌的小鸟和装满花朵的推车设计的春天 banner 矢量素材,提供了 AI 和 EPS 两种格式,含 JPG 预览图。
banner图
2024-02-29

驾照考试驾校HTML5网站模板

驾照考试驾校HTML5网站模板是一款适合提供驾驶培训和组织驾照考试服务机构宣传网站模板下载。提示:本模板调用到谷歌字体库,可能会出现页面打开比较缓慢。
前端模板
2025-06-10

驾照培训服务机构宣传网站模板

驾照培训服务机构宣传网站模板是一款适合提供一般驾驶和计划培训的驾校宣传网站模板下载。提示:本模板调用到谷歌字体库,可能会出现页面打开比较缓慢。
前端模板
2025-01-07

新鲜有机肉类宣传网站模板

新鲜有机肉类宣传网站模板是一款适合提供各种新鲜有机肉类食材宣传网站模板下载。提示:本模板调用到谷歌字体库,可能会出现页面打开比较缓慢。
前端模板
2025-01-06

HTML5房地产公司宣传网站模板

HTML5房地产公司宣传网站模板是一款适合从事房地产服务行业宣传网站模板下载。提示:本模板调用到谷歌字体库,可能会出现页面打开比较缓慢。
前端模板
2025-01-06
关于我们 免责申明 意见反馈 讲师合作 广告合作 最新更新
php中文网:公益在线php培训,帮助PHP学习者快速成长!
关注服务号 技术交流群
PHP中文网订阅号
每天精选资源文章推送
PHP中文网APP
随时随地碎片化学习
PHP中文网抖音号
发现有趣的

Copyright 2014-2025 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号